Infrastructure Engineer Company: $40M-Funded Series A Industrial Technology Startup Location: San Francisco, CA Work Arrangement: Onsite, five days per week Compensation: $150,000 to $175,000 base salary, plus equity Experience: Ideally 3 to 8 years About the Company Our client is a VC-backed industrial technology startup rebuilding America’s metal supply through advanced recycling and computer vision technology. The company has developed novel sortation technology that separates mixed scrap into pure alloys, as well as computer vision sensors that help recycling facilities price materials accurately and detect fraud in real time. Backed by $40 million in Series A funding, the company is a small, high-caliber team preparing to scale its technology across hundreds of customer locations nationwide. About the Role The company is hiring its first dedicated Infrastructure Engineer to own the operational foundation of its sensor platform. You will take end-to-end responsibility for cloud infrastructure, infrastructure-as-code, deployment pipelines, observability, incident response, reliability, and cost controls. This is a hands-on role for an engineer who has scaled production infrastructure and is comfortable operating independently within an early-stage environment. This is not an application-development position with occasional DevOps responsibilities.
